Thryonomys swinderianus

The greater cane rat, also known as the grasscutter, is one of two species of cane rats, a small family of African hystricognath rodents. It lives by reed-beds and riverbanks in Sub-Saharan Africa.

Time the record covers

At most 2.6 million years on record.

Every occurrence read is dated to somewhere between 2.58 Mya and 0 Mya, and nothing in the dating separates them, so that window is what the record shows rather than a span.

13 occurrences of Thryonomys swinderianus on record, most of them in the Holocene. The Paleobiology Database records this as a living group. Bar height is expected occurrences, not a count: each fossil is spread across the span it is dated to, so a tall narrow bar means tight dating and a low wide one means loose.
